    Abstract: The present invention relates to a tufted fabric and a method of manufacturing the same. The tufted fabric generally comprises a primary backing and tufts mounted in the primary backing to form a fabric with a faceside having piles and a backside having loops. A thermoplastic polymer adhesive, which bonds the tufts to the primary backing, is formed by applying a reactive mixture comprising a polymerizable monomer to the backside of the tufted fabric and in-situ polymerizing the monomers to form the thermoplastic polymer adhesive. The process is particularly advantageous for the manufacture of recyclable tufted fabrics in which the adhesive polymer and tufts are formed from substantially the same polymer. The tufted fabric can be used in articles, such as, for example carpets, rugs and upholstery.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a flexible polyamide composition containing at least 50 parts by weight of non-cross-linked rubber per 50 parts by weight of polyamide and the production thereof. The polyamide has a molecular weight such that the melt viscosity at the processing temperature is at most 300 Pa.s, preferably at most 200 Pa.s. The rubber's Mooney viscosity is at least 40, most preferable is a rubber with a Mooney viscosity of at least 60. The rubber has been functionalized. Preferably a combination of a functionalized and a non-functionalized rubber is used. The rubber particles in the polyamide matrix have a particle size of at most 5 mu m, preferably at most 3 mu m.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a method for the preparation of melamine from urea in which solid melamine is obtained by transferring the melamine stream leaving the reactor to a product cooling unit where the melamine stream is cooled to a temperature below 175 DEG C. More in particular it relates to a method for the preparation of melamine from urea via a non-catalytic high-pressure process by transferring the melamine melt leaving the reactor to a product cooling unit where the melamine is recovered by cooling the melamine melt using a cooling medium, the melamine melt being cooled to a temperature below 175 DEG C.

    Abstract: Provided is a radiation-curable, optical glass fiber coating composition containing at least one radiation-curable oligomer or monomer, and at least one chromophoric indicator selected so as to be susceptible to destruction of its chromophoric characteristic upon exposure to radiation and present in an amount which becomes substantially colorless when exposed to a level of radiation sufficient to cure said radiation-curable, optical glass fiber coating composition, wherein said at least one chromophoric indicator has a color which is distinguishable from a base color of said radiation-curable, optical glass fiber coating composition in cured form. The invention also provides a method of making the coating composition. The invention further provides a coated optical glass fiber and a method of making a coated optical glass on a fiber drawing tower. Also provided is a cable and telecommunications system.
